DNA damage checkpoint pathway modulates the regulation of skeletal growth and osteoblastic bone formation by parathyroid hormone-related peptide

We previously demonstrated that parathyroid hormone-related peptide (PTHrP) 1-84 knockin (Pthrp KI) mice, which lacked a PTHrP nuclear localization sequence (NLS) and C-terminus, displayed early senescence, defective osteoblastic bone formation, and skeletal growth retardation.
